Why Choose Aluminium Windows for Your Home?
Aluminium windows are popular in modern self-builds, but they're suitable for period homes as well as extensions, renovations and additions. They're available in any colour RAL and provide superior weather protection and thermal efficiency.
Aluminum frames today have slim sightlines, allowing for more glass and a more sleek appearance. They can also be powder coated in a wide range of colours.
Cost
Aluminium windows are available in many designs and colors. They are extremely robust and offer an excellent energy efficiency. They are a great choice for new homes, but they can also be used for renovations and refurbishment.
They are simple to install and can be incorporated into any style of architecture. They are smaller and less bulky than other windows. This allows more natural light to flood into a space. They are also resistant to the elements and require minimal maintenance. They are an affordable option for both business and home owners.
Aluminium frames are available in a range of finishes that include powder coated. This process involves spraying polyester powder onto aluminium to give it an attractive and long-lasting finish. This is a more durable option than paint and has more colors. You can even have the hinges and handles painted the same colour as the frame to create a uniform and coordinated look.

Energy efficiency
Aluminium windows are well-known for their energy efficiency, and can help you save money on heating and cooling costs. They are extremely insulating, keeping the heat inside in winter and cool air out in summer. This is a great way to reduce your carbon footprint and is a great choice for offices and homes. Additionally, aluminium windows are durable and last for a long time. They also have a sleek design that is ideal for modern homes.
Aluminium is a popular choice for windows that are new, mostly because it's lightweight and simple to manufacture. It is also recyclable and has a minimal impact on the environment. It is also extremely strong and is able to withstand the most extreme weather conditions. Aluminium is also easy to maintain and has a low corrosion risk.

In recent years, there's been a change in the minimum energy standards for doors and windows which has caused anxiety among homeowners who are concerned that their windows made of aluminium could not meet the new standards. It is crucial to remember that aluminum is a naturally efficient thermal material. Aluminium windows feature polyamide thermal breaks as well as multi-chambered chambers that prevent unwanted air from entering your home. Maintenance
Aluminium windows are a long-lasting and sturdy choice for your home. They are resistant to the elements, which includes sun, dust and water damage. They are easy to clean and require minimal maintenance. To keep them looking fresh just wipe them clean with a damp rag. You can pick from a variety of colours, too. They also come with a guarantee from the manufacturer.
Aluminium is a tough and resilient metal, making it the ideal material for windows. The frames of aluminium window frames are also welded together to form an entire unit. This means that burglars won't be able to gain entry through a slit or popping the windows out of place.
Many manufacturers offer a range of finishes and colors for aluminium windows. Certain manufacturers employ powder coatings to give an attractive finish, while others employ wet paint. Both are viable options, but it is important to select a company that makes use of high quality aluminium. Cheaper aluminium is likely to crack or fade in time.
The top manufacturers of aluminium windows utilize a high-quality polyester powder coat, which is available in a vast variety of colors. The dies are also polished after each extrusion. This reduces corrosion and enhances the final product. A powder coated aluminium window will be virtually maintenance-free needing only a periodic wipe with a damp cloth to keep it in pristine condition.
